Troubleshooting License Management for ESX 3.x/ESXi 3.5 Hosts

If vCenter Server is managing ESX 3.x/ESXi 3.5 hosts, vCenter Server must check out vCenter Server Agent licenses from the license server. If vCenter Server is having trouble communicating with your license server, do the following:

heck that the license server Windows service is running.

· Check that the license server is listening.

· Check the license server status.

Check that the License Server Windows Service Is Running

License management fails if the license server Windows service is not running.

To check that the license server Windows service is running

1 On the machine on which the license server is installed, select Start > Control Panel >

Administrative Tools > Services to display the Services control panel.

2 Verify that the Status column for the VMware License Server entry reads Started.

3 If the VMware License Server is not started, right?click the service and select Start.

Check That the License Server Is Listening

This procedure allows you to verify that the license server is installed and is started.

To check  VMware license server is listening

1 On the machine on which the license server is installed, select Start > Command Prompt.

2 Type netstat -ab at the command line.

3 Verify that the lmgrd.exe process is listening on port 27000 and that the VMWARELM.exe process is listening on port 27010.

If not, the license server might not be installed or might not be started.
